Embracing the Bob: Short Hair Tips from Stars

Short hair has been making a major comeback in recent years, and we couldn't be more thrilled. With the rise of the bob haircut, many women are opting to chop off their long locks and embrace a shorter, more manageable style. If you're considering going for the chop yourself or have recently taken the plunge, we've got some tips and tricks to help you navigate the world of short hair.

1. Find the Right Barber

When it comes to cutting short hair, it's crucial to find a barber who specializes in shorter styles. Look for a barber who has experience and expertise in creating bobs and other short haircuts. They will understand the nuances of cutting short hair and know how to shape it to flatter your face shape and features. Don't be afraid to ask for recommendations or do some research online to find the best barber in your area.

2. Don't Skimp on Products

Short hair may require less time to style, but that doesn't mean you should skimp on products. Invest in high-quality styling products that are specifically formulated for short hair. Look for a lightweight texturizing spray or a pomade to add volume and definition. These products will help you achieve that effortless, tousled look that's so popular with bobs. And remember, a little goes a long way with short hair, so start with a small amount and build up if needed.

3. Experiment with Different Textures

One of the great things about having short hair is that it's versatile and allows you to experiment with different textures. Embrace your natural texture by air-drying your hair or use a diffuser to enhance your natural waves or curls. If you prefer a sleeker look, use a flat iron to straighten your hair or try a wet look by applying a gel or styling cream while your hair is still damp. Have fun playing around with different textures to find what suits you best.

4. Don't Forget the Accessories

Just because you have short hair doesn't mean you can't accessorize. In fact, short hair is the perfect canvas for showcasing fun and stylish accessories. Experiment with headbands, hair clips, and barrettes to add interest and flair to your bob. Not only will they elevate your hairstyle, but they'll also help keep your hair out of your face when you're on the go. Let your creativity shine and have fun accessorizing your short hair.

5. Keep Up with Regular Trims

Short haircuts require regular maintenance to stay looking their best, so don't neglect those trims. Aim to visit your barber every 4-6 weeks to keep your bob in shape and prevent it from growing out unevenly. Regular trims also help to eliminate split ends and keep your hair healthy and vibrant. Plus, there's nothing quite like that fresh-from-the-barber feeling, so enjoy the pampering and keep up with those regular trims.

6. Embrace the Power of Dry Shampoo

Dry shampoo is a game-changer for short-haired girls. Because short hair is closer to your scalp, it's more prone to becoming greasy quickly. Enter dry shampoo, the ultimate time-saving product that absorbs excess oil and refreshes your hair in between washes. Not only does it help extend the life of your blowout, but it also adds texture and volume to your roots. Say goodbye to greasy hair days and hello to fresh, voluminous locks with the power of dry shampoo.

7. Take Advantage of the Versatility

Short hair may have a reputation for being limiting, but that couldn't be further from the truth. The bob haircut is incredibly versatile and can be styled in a variety of ways to suit any occasion. Whether you want a sleek and sophisticated look for a corporate event or a tousled and effortless look for a night out with friends, the bob can do it all. Experiment with different styling techniques, play with accessories, and have fun embracing the versatility of short hair.

8. Play with Color

Short hair provides the perfect opportunity to experiment with different hair colors. Whether you want to go for a subtle change with highlights or make a bold statement with a vibrant hue, the choice is yours. Talk to your barber about different color options and find a shade that complements your skin tone and personality. Adding color to your short hair can instantly elevate your style and give you a fresh and exciting look.

9. Use the Right Tools

Having the right tools in your arsenal is essential for styling short hair. Invest in a good quality flat iron and a curling wand to create different looks. A flat iron can help you achieve sleek and straight styles, while a curling wand can add soft waves or curls to your bob. Additionally, consider using a small round brush and a blow dryer with a concentrator nozzle to create volume and shape when styling your hair.

10. Protect Your Hair

Short hair is more prone to damage from heat styling and environmental factors. To keep your hair healthy and strong, it's important to protect it. Before using any heat styling tools, apply a heat protectant spray or serum to shield your hair from the high temperatures. When spending time in the sun, wear a hat or use a UV protectant hair spray to prevent sun damage. And don't forget to use a deep conditioning treatment once a week to nourish and hydrate your hair.

11. Get Inspired by Celebrities

If you're ever in need of hairstyle inspiration, look to your favorite celebrities with short hair. From classic icons like Audrey Hepburn to modern trendsetters like Emma Watson, there are countless celebrities who have rocked short hair and made it look effortlessly chic. Browse magazines, red carpet photos, and social media to find inspiration and discover new ways to style your bob. Don't be afraid to take risks and try out different looks that catch your eye.

12. Opt for Bedhead Vibes

Messy, bedhead hair has a certain effortless charm that looks great with a bob. Embrace the "I woke up like this" aesthetic and don't be afraid to embrace a slightly tousled look. Use a texturizing spray or dry shampoo to add volume and create that mussed-up, bedhead effect. Run your fingers through your hair and tousle it to add extra texture. The beauty of short hair is that imperfections can actually enhance your overall style.

13. Find the Right Products for Your Hair Type

Just as finding the right barber is important, so is finding the right products for your specific hair type. If you have fine hair, look for lightweight products that add volume without weighing your hair down. For thick or coarse hair, opt for creams or oils that provide moisture and control frizz. If your hair is on the dry side, consider using a leave-in conditioner or a hydrating hair mask to keep it soft and nourished. Experiment with different products until you find the ones that work best for you.

14. Consider a Fresh Cut

If you're already sporting a bob but want to change things up, consider asking your barber for a fresh cut. Bobs come in many variations, such as an angled bob, a layered bob, or a stacked bob. These different cuts can add dimension and movement to your hair, giving it a whole new look. Talk to your barber about your desired outcome and let them work their magic to give you a fresh and updated style.

15. Confidence is Key

Lastly, the most important tip for rocking short hair is to have confidence in yourself and your style. Short hair can be a big change, and it may take time to adjust and feel comfortable with your new look. But remember that confidence is the best accessory you can wear. Be proud of your decision to embrace the bob and own it. When you feel good about yourself and your style, it will shine through and make you even more stunning.
